不终天年

不終天年
bùzhōngtiānnián
idiom

Meanings

  1. 1 to die before one's allotted lifespan has run its course (idiom)
  2. 2 to die prematurely

Examples

Tā yīngnián zǎoshì, bù zhōng tiān nián, lìng rén wǎnxī.
He died young, never finishing his natural span — a deeply regrettable thing.
Gǔrén rènwéi bàobìng shēnwáng shì bù zhōng tiān nián de bēijù.
The ancients regarded sudden death from illness as the tragedy of not finishing one's natural lifespan.

Tips

culture
天年 (tiānnián) is the lifespan Heaven ordained for you — in Confucian and Daoist thought, ideally around the canonical 'three score and ten' or beyond. To 不终天年 is to be cut down by violence, illness, or war before reaching that allotted span. The phrase carries a sympathetic, slightly fatalistic tone — see also the antonym 颐养天年 'to live out one's natural years in peace'.
